Introduction
While fat is a necessary component of the human body, serving vital functions such as energy storage, vitamin absorption, and hormone production, excessive or abnormal accumulation of fat can have severe and wide-ranging negative consequences. The health risks associated with too much body fat are not limited to just physical ailments but also extend to psychological well-being and overall quality of life. The location and type of fat stored also play a crucial role in determining the health impact, with deep, visceral fat posing a greater threat than the subcutaneous fat just under the skin. The Physiological Toll: How Excess Fat Harms Your Body
Cardiovascular Disease and Metabolic Syndrome
Excess fat places immense strain on the cardiovascular system. It contributes to high blood pressure (hypertension), forcing the heart to pump harder to circulate blood throughout the body. High levels of triglycerides and "bad" LDL cholesterol often accompany excess weight, while levels of "good" HDL cholesterol drop. This unhealthy lipid profile promotes the buildup of fatty plaques in the arteries, leading to atherosclerosis, which can cause heart attacks and strokes. Furthermore, excess fat is a key factor in the development of metabolic syndrome, a cluster of conditions that includes increased blood pressure, high blood sugar, excess body fat around the waist, and abnormal cholesterol levels, all of which significantly increase the risk of heart disease and type 2 diabetes.
Chronic Inflammation
Adipose tissue, especially visceral fat, is not just a passive storage unit; it's an active endocrine organ that releases various hormones and pro-inflammatory chemicals called cytokines. When fat cells become overloaded, they trigger a state of chronic, low-grade systemic inflammation. This ongoing inflammatory state can damage tissues and organs throughout the body, contributing to a host of chronic diseases. For example, it can worsen insulin resistance, further contributing to metabolic dysfunction, and play a role in the development of atherosclerosis and certain cancers.
Organ Dysfunction
Excess fat can directly harm vital organs. The liver, in particular, is vulnerable, with fat accumulation leading to non-alcoholic fatty liver disease (NAFLD). This condition, if left unchecked, can progress to more severe liver damage, including cirrhosis and liver failure. Excess weight also stresses the kidneys, leading to chronic kidney disease over time, often driven by the associated high blood pressure and diabetes. Additionally, higher cholesterol levels in obese individuals can cause gallstones and other gallbladder diseases.
Impact on the Musculoskeletal System
Carrying extra body weight puts increased pressure on weight-bearing joints such as the knees, hips, and lower back. This mechanical stress can wear down cartilage and lead to painful and debilitating osteoarthritis. The inflammatory state caused by excess fat also contributes to joint problems by inflaming the joints themselves. Another painful joint condition, gout, is also more prevalent in people with obesity, as it is linked to higher levels of uric acid in the blood.
Respiratory Complications
Excess fat, particularly in the chest and neck area, can compress airways and hinder lung function. This can lead to breathing problems such as sleep apnea, a serious disorder where breathing repeatedly stops and starts during sleep. Sleep apnea can further exacerbate cardiovascular problems. Obesity is also a known risk factor for developing asthma and can make existing asthma symptoms worse.
Hormonal Imbalance and Endocrine Disruption
Obesity profoundly affects the endocrine system. It disrupts the signaling of hormones that regulate appetite, such as leptin, leading to leptin resistance where the brain no longer properly receives the signal of fullness. Insulin resistance is another critical hormonal consequence, leading to type 2 diabetes. Furthermore, sex hormone levels can be altered; for example, excess fat tissue can increase estrogen production in men and postmenopausal women, which is linked to an increased risk of certain cancers. In men, obesity can lead to lower testosterone levels, contributing to a cycle of weight gain and further hormonal disruption.
Increased Cancer Risk
Numerous studies have linked excess body fat to an increased risk of several types of cancer. The specific cancers associated with obesity include, but are not limited to, those of the colon, breast, uterus, pancreas, kidney, and gallbladder. The mechanisms are thought to involve chronic inflammation, hormonal imbalances, and other metabolic changes caused by obesity.
The Psychological and Social Consequences
Mental Health Challenges
Beyond the physical toll, excess fat can significantly impact mental health. The relationship is often bidirectional, with psychological issues both contributing to and resulting from excess weight. Individuals with obesity are at a higher risk of developing depression and anxiety, often stemming from low self-esteem and poor body image. The societal stigma and discrimination faced by people with larger bodies can lead to feelings of shame, guilt, and social isolation, creating a vicious cycle of emotional distress and unhealthy eating behaviors.
Diminished Quality of Life
Obesity can limit one's ability to participate in physical activities they once enjoyed, leading to a more sedentary lifestyle. Social withdrawal and avoidance of public places can also become common due to fear of judgment or discrimination. These factors, combined with the physical discomfort and health complications, can lead to a reduced overall quality of life.
Visceral Fat vs. Subcutaneous Fat: A Critical Difference
Not all body fat is created equal. The location where fat is stored matters significantly regarding health risks. Here's a comparison:
| Feature | Subcutaneous Fat | Visceral Fat |
|---|---|---|
| Location | Stored directly beneath the skin, often on the arms, thighs, and buttocks. It's the fat you can pinch. | Stored deep within the abdomen, surrounding internal organs like the liver, pancreas, and intestines. |
| Appearance | Gives a "pear" shape when concentrated on the hips and thighs. | Contributes to the "apple" shape, where the stomach protrudes. |
| Metabolic Activity | Less metabolically active and generally considered less harmful in moderate amounts. | Highly metabolically active, secreting inflammatory cytokines and fatty acids into the bloodstream. |
| Associated Health Risks | While excessive amounts still contribute to obesity, it poses a lower immediate risk than visceral fat. | Strongly linked to metabolic syndrome, heart disease, insulin resistance, type 2 diabetes, certain cancers, and inflammation. |
| Risk Factor | Less of a predictor for cardiometabolic diseases. | A major predictor of serious health problems. |
Conclusion: Taking Control of Your Health
The negative effects of fat are multifaceted and impact almost every aspect of an individual's health, from the cardiovascular system to mental well-being. The risks are particularly pronounced with an excess of visceral fat, which acts as a harmful endocrine organ. However, these effects are largely preventable and manageable. Losing even a modest amount of excess weight can significantly reduce these health risks. Engaging in a healthy lifestyle that includes a balanced diet and regular physical activity can help mitigate the long-term consequences of excess fat and lead to a longer, healthier life. Simple Steps for a Healthier Path:
- Prioritize a balanced diet: Focus on whole foods, lean proteins, fruits, and vegetables while reducing processed foods, refined sugars, and unhealthy fats.
- Increase physical activity: Aim for at least 30 minutes of moderate-intensity activity on most days to help burn calories and improve overall health.
- Manage stress effectively: Use techniques like meditation, deep breathing, or spending time in nature to cope with stress rather than turning to food.
- Get enough sleep: Lack of sleep can disrupt hormone regulation, increasing appetite and the risk of weight gain.
- Seek professional help: Consult a healthcare provider or a registered dietitian for a personalized plan to address your specific health needs.
